stock was 26.1 tall ,

the 245s titan spoke of on 16s are 245/50-16 and they are 25.6" tall (but still 245mm wide when new but the edges round off quick) mine were probably less than 25" where they rubbed the fender liner with gta rims

the 245/60-15 you asked about are 26.6" tall and still 245mm wide so plan on them rubbing on turns more than those guys that run gta fronts with 245s and mostlikely hitting inside the fender on bumps more often too , i wouldnt run taller than stock upfront
as cruzn posted the popular upsize for front with 15s is the 235/60-15 which is 26.1 tall
not much else available for the 15 rim
